2. Aftershoot best for fast AI culling and editing

Aftershoot is a desktop AI culling and editing tool. It learns your selection style, flags duplicates and closed eyes, and can apply edits in your look. It's a strong choice for trimming a big shoot down to keepers before you edit. It doesn't sort by guest or deliver galleries, so you'd pair it with a separate delivery tool. Best for: photographers who want to speed up culling and editing on their own computer. Typically subscription-based.

3. Narrative Select best for low-cost culling

Narrative Select is a fast culling app that groups similar shots and detects closed eyes and focus so you can pick the best frame quickly. It offers a free tier, which makes it popular with photographers starting out. Like Aftershoot, it focuses on culling not face-based sorting or client delivery. Best for: budget-conscious photographers who mainly need help culling.

4. Pixieset best all-round client galleries

Pixieset is a widely used client gallery and delivery platform with proofing, downloads, and a store. It's polished and easy for clients, but it's a delivery tool it doesn't AI-cull your shoot or sort photos by the person in them. Best for: photographers who want clean, shared client galleries and online print sales. Freemium with paid plans.

5. Pic-Time best for sales automation

Pic-Time is a gallery platform known for marketing and sales automation reminder emails, promotions, and a built-in store. Like Pixieset, its strength is delivery and selling, not AI culling or face-based sorting. Best for: photographers focused on driving print and product sales from their galleries. Subscription-based.

6. ShootProof best for galleries plus print fulfillment

ShootProof combines galleries, contracts, invoicing, and print sales into one business hub. It's great for delivery and selling, but it doesn't do AI culling or sort photos by guest. Best for: photographers who want delivery plus business tools in a single platform. Subscription-based.

What's the difference between photo culling and photo sorting?

Culling removes bad frames (blurry, blinked, duplicates); sorting organizes the keepers. Lenzeit also sorts by the person in each photo and delivers to that guest.
